> Would it make sense to add `; \' to all internal lines in the not
> generated Makefiles?
Echoing Keith's "No" it would make sense to not have them unless they're
something like an if-statement or a change to the environment, e.g.
current working directory, is needed by later commands. Also, sometimes
those `;' could perhaps be `&&' to mimic make's own `stop on failure' if
a `set -e' isn't in place.
